What is Leed

LEED stands for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design. It is a certification program developed by the United States Green Building Council (USGBC) to evaluate and promote sustainable and environmentally friendly building design, construction, and operation. The program provides a voluntary credit rating system that helps professionals in the lighting industry achieve maximum sustainability and efficiency in their projects.

LEED certification operates on a points-based system, where projects earn points for meeting specific requirements and guidelines. The points are then used to determine the overall rating of a project within the LEED system. The certification levels range from Certified to Silver, Gold, and Platinum, with Platinum being the highest rating.

The specific requirements and guidelines in the LEED system cover a wide range of aspects related to energy and environmental design. This includes considerations such as building materials, energy efficiency, water conservation, indoor environmental quality, site selection, transportation, and innovation in design. By following the LEED rating system, professionals in the lighting industry can ensure that their projects are designed and constructed in a sustainable and environmentally friendly manner.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Is LEED Certified Mean

LEED certification refers to a globally recognized program that certifies buildings and neighborhoods as high-performance green structures. It sets the standard for their design, construction, and operation, ensuring they meet environmentally friendly criteria.

What Does LEED Measure

LEED, also known as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design, is a globally acknowledged system for certifying and rating green buildings.

What Does LEED Stand for in HVAC

LEED stands for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design.

How Does LEED Work

To obtain LEED certification, a project can accumulate points by meeting the requirements and criteria related to carbon, energy, water, waste, transportation, materials, health, and indoor environmental quality.

How Important Is LEED Certification

LEED certification is highly significant as it offers a globally recognized symbol of achievement and leadership in sustainability. It is available for various building types and provides a framework for creating healthy, efficient, and cost-saving green buildings that offer environmental, social, and governance benefits.

What Makes a Product LEED Certified

LEED certification is awarded to various types of structures, including buildings, spaces, neighborhoods, homes, cities, and communities, that meet the program’s criteria for being environmentally friendly. The LEED rating system evaluates the overall environmental performance of these structures based on their comprehensive strategies and whole-building characteristics, and awards credits or points accordingly.
